amkozlov / raxml-ng

RAxML Next Generation: faster, easier-to-use and more flexible
GNU Affero General Public License v3.0
374 stars 62 forks source link

Error: assertion failed #161

Open greektash opened 12 months ago

greektash commented 12 months ago

Hi there, I'm using raxml-ng version 1.2.0 on a Macbook M1. I keep getting a variety of errors (log attached) - either "Assertion failed" error or "libc++abi: terminating due to uncaught exception". These persist despite adding blopt nr_safe, removing identical sequences, uninstalling & reinstalling raxml-ng, and recreating the input file to ensure all okay... Nothing's worked so far! Weirdly, after the attempt aborts, I can often get it started again, and it'll manage a few more bootstraps (picking up from where it left off last time) and then abort again. Any ideas?! Thanks in advance :-)

raxlog.txt

amkozlov commented 11 months ago

Thanks for reporting!

Could you please:

  1. Check if you get the same error in x86 emulation mode (rosetta)
  2. Send me your input files
greektash commented 11 months ago

Hi there, Thanks for that. Yes, I’ve re-run it with Rosetta2 and still getting errors (below). Input file and most recent log attached. Thanks in advance for your help, and best wishes,

libc++abi: terminating due to uncaught exception of type std::runtime_error: ERROR in SPR round (LIBPLL-2240): BL opt converged to a worse likelihood score by -14.658877165522426 units

zsh: abort raxml-ng --all --msa clean.full.noref.fasta --model GTR+G --prefix Nlac --see

From: Alexey Kozlov @.> Date: Tuesday, 18 July 2023 at 17:37 To: amkozlov/raxml-ng @.> Cc: Anastasia Theodosiou @.>, Author @.> Subject: Re: [amkozlov/raxml-ng] Error: assertion failed (Issue #161) This email was sent to you by someone outside the University. You should only click on links or attachments if you are certain that the email is genuine and the content is safe.

Thanks for reporting!

Could you please:

  1. Check if you get the same error in x86 emulation mode (rosetta)
  2. Send me your input files

— Reply to this email directly, view it on GitHubhttps://github.com/amkozlov/raxml-ng/issues/161#issuecomment-1640564131, or unsubscribehttps://github.com/notifications/unsubscribe-auth/A4GIC2K4ZU5M57QGZI7SZWTXQ23TJANCNFSM6AAAAAA2H3HNNI. You are receiving this because you authored the thread.Message ID: @.***>

The University of Edinburgh is a charitable body, registered in Scotland, with registration number SC005336. Is e buidheann carthannais a th’ ann an Oilthigh Dhùn Èideann, clàraichte an Alba, àireamh clàraidh SC005336.

amkozlov commented 11 months ago

sorry but I don't see the attachment

greektash commented 11 months ago

Hiya, I’ve tried resending, but I get a mail delivery notification saying the attachment is too large (I think this is an issue on your end, as it’s within the size limits for me to send). Is there another email address I can send to?

From: Alexey Kozlov @.> Date: Monday, 24 July 2023 at 12:05 To: amkozlov/raxml-ng @.> Cc: Anastasia Theodosiou @.>, Author @.> Subject: Re: [amkozlov/raxml-ng] Error: assertion failed (Issue #161) This email was sent to you by someone outside the University. You should only click on links or attachments if you are certain that the email is genuine and the content is safe.

sorry but I don't see the attachment

— Reply to this email directly, view it on GitHubhttps://github.com/amkozlov/raxml-ng/issues/161#issuecomment-1647698037, or unsubscribehttps://github.com/notifications/unsubscribe-auth/A4GIC2M63RKDHJ7THZIULK3XRZJF3ANCNFSM6AAAAAA2H3HNNI. You are receiving this because you authored the thread.Message ID: @.***>

The University of Edinburgh is a charitable body, registered in Scotland, with registration number SC005336. Is e buidheann carthannais a th’ ann an Oilthigh Dhùn Èideann, clàraichte an Alba, àireamh clàraidh SC005336.

amkozlov commented 11 months ago

please try alexey.kozlov (at) h-its (dot) com

or just share it via google drive or similar

greektash commented 11 months ago

I've shared an item with you:

clean.full.noref.fasta.gz https://drive.google.com/file/d/1lv8Pm98FpI65XUChrgMFTdBSq-ZzugX_/view?usp=sharing&invite=CJiuzqUL&ts=64c7ae52

It's not an attachment -- it's stored online. To open this item, just click
the link above.

greektash commented 11 months ago

Hi there, I’ve just received another delivery failure notification from the email I sent you last week with the zipped input file. I’ve now sent this to you again as a Google drive link from my gmail account, hope that works! Here is the link: https://drive.google.com/file/d/1lv8Pm98FpI65XUChrgMFTdBSq-ZzugX_/view?usp=drive_link

From: Alexey Kozlov @.> Date: Monday, 24 July 2023 at 12:36 To: amkozlov/raxml-ng @.> Cc: Anastasia Theodosiou @.>, Author @.> Subject: Re: [amkozlov/raxml-ng] Error: assertion failed (Issue #161) This email was sent to you by someone outside the University. You should only click on links or attachments if you are certain that the email is genuine and the content is safe.

please try alexey.kozlov (at) h-its (dot) com

or just share it via google drive or similar

— Reply to this email directly, view it on GitHubhttps://github.com/amkozlov/raxml-ng/issues/161#issuecomment-1647741912, or unsubscribehttps://github.com/notifications/unsubscribe-auth/A4GIC2PGDUQS3OGROFQ5OS3XRZM5HANCNFSM6AAAAAA2H3HNNI. You are receiving this because you authored the thread.Message ID: @.***>

The University of Edinburgh is a charitable body, registered in Scotland, with registration number SC005336. Is e buidheann carthannais a th’ ann an Oilthigh Dhùn Èideann, clàraichte an Alba, àireamh clàraidh SC005336.

amkozlov commented 11 months ago

Hi, thanks for the file!

I now can reproduce the problem, but.don't have a fix yet.

So for the time being, please try x86 mac version which seems to work fine on this dataset:

https://github.com/amkozlov/raxml-ng/releases/download/1.2.0/raxml-ng_v1.2.0_macos_x86_64.zip

greektash commented 11 months ago

Thanks, I've installed the x86 version and run with Rosetta and it worked fine! Appreciate your help, Best wishes,

Sent from Outlook for Androidhttps://aka.ms/AAb9ysg


From: Alexey Kozlov @.> Sent: Tuesday, August 1, 2023 4:42:31 PM To: amkozlov/raxml-ng @.> Cc: Anastasia Theodosiou @.>; Author @.> Subject: Re: [amkozlov/raxml-ng] Error: assertion failed (Issue #161)

This email was sent to you by someone outside the University. You should only click on links or attachments if you are certain that the email is genuine and the content is safe.

Hi, thanks for the file!

I now can reproduce the problem, but.don't have a fix yet.

So for the time being, please try x86 mac version which seems to work fine on this dataset:

https://github.com/amkozlov/raxml-ng/releases/download/1.2.0/raxml-ng_v1.2.0_macos_x86_64.zip

— Reply to this email directly, view it on GitHubhttps://github.com/amkozlov/raxml-ng/issues/161#issuecomment-1660583081, or unsubscribehttps://github.com/notifications/unsubscribe-auth/A4GIC2IYI7K535UN72QIIVDXTEPWPANCNFSM6AAAAAA2H3HNNI. You are receiving this because you authored the thread.Message ID: @.***>

The University of Edinburgh is a charitable body, registered in Scotland, with registration number SC005336. Is e buidheann carthannais a th’ ann an Oilthigh Dhùn Èideann, clàraichte an Alba, àireamh clàraidh SC005336.